  9. CAMP (also spelled C.A.M.P. and called Camp) is one of the world's leading manufacturers of equipment for climbing and associated activities such as ski mountaineering and industrial safety. The company is based in Italy.
  10. The Camp is the term used in the Falkland Islands to refer to any part of the islands outside of the islands' only significant town, Stanley, and often the large RAF base at Mount Pleasant. It is a Spanglish term derived from the Argentine Spanish "campo", for "countryside".
  11. Camp is a 2003 American independent musical film written and directed by Todd Graff, about an upstate New York performing arts summer camp. The film is based on Graff's own experiences at a similar camp called Stagedoor Manor. The film was released in 2003 by IFC Films.

  19. Cyclic AMP. A form of the nucleotide adenosine monophosphate that serves as a signaling molecule within and between cells.
